Hello Felstag,
these two are quite doable. With Al-Hezmin it is all about knowing the fight and its stages + what to avoid and how. There are some quite good guide-videos on youtube. Just search for them on youtube (easy to find). + You can use the pantheon for reducing certain damage types. Just search for it a little bit, it is worth your time, because this will help you a lot with other bosses. You would like to upgrade your pantheon as well, using a divine vessel. With Veritania as a melee (like you are), it is a bit more difficult. Try to boost your cold-resistance really high, much over 75% base (certain items, skill tree points, flasks) + you can easily distract her by using a decoy totem or/and one vaal-skeleton gem. Vaal skelletons gives you a lot of breathing space for its duration and this works with a lot of bosses. And watch some of the really good youtube-guides about her fight. You can learn alot from them. regards + good luck |

Those 2 are perfectly fine as they are, you just need to learn the fights/up your gear if you have trouble with them.
Al Hezmins moves all have a long ass telegraph and don't hurt much even if you ignore them unless your chaos res are deep in the red. Slightly positive chaos res and shakari makes him a non issue. The most dangerous part about him is the phase where the 3 snakes spawn in the middle and attack while he is running circles. If you aren't confident in your ability do dodge those snakes just do what he does and run circles until the phase ends. They literally can't hit you if you just keep moving. Veritania has 3 dangerous moves, 2 of which have an audio cue and again a long ass wind up. The trickiest part of her is the fact that she has 2 auto attacks. Her normal one where she sends out projectile by swinging one of her wings which can be ignored since it does basically zero damage. In her second version however she uses both wings and that one is deadly if you don't know about it. But again, if you look out for it and just dodge it's a non issue. You also seem to misunderstand something about capping resists. Capped resis are not an optional defense layer in this game, they are a mandatory requirement and the devs balance monsters to be a threat to you assuming you have capped resists. If you want to have actual meaningful defense against elemental damage you have to go beyond that. The assumption that you shouldn't get oneshot when you have max res is also completely off because whether you get oneshot by elemental damage does not only depend on your resists but also on your hp pool. Plus there are other damage types that aren't affected by ele res and that can and will oneshot you as well if you don't have defenses for them. Al Hezmin for example isn't doing any elemental damage at all so your capped res are meaningless. Last edited by Baharoth15#0429 on Jul 6, 2021, 1:35:01 AM

As others mentioned, these 2 are actually the more well-designed and enjoyable fights. I used to struggle with Al Hezmin but once you learnt about the inner and outer triangle, and be patient with the fight, they are manageable. For Veritania, you can also try to warcry to lure her out of the spinning cloud when she stays there too long. I still find Baran the most difficult, especially when you are melee and mess up the runes timings, and the lightning circles can overlap and easily one shot you, since they can have poor visibility at times. |
